Strategic Partnerships That Amplify Scholarly Impact
The Contemporary Innovations Journal welcomes formal partnerships with universities, research institutes, professional associations, government bodies, intergovernmental organisations, and corporate research divisions.
Advancing global knowledge requires collaboration at scale — and CIJ has designed partnership models that create genuine, measurable value for all stakeholders.
Universities and research institutions may enter into dedicated publishing agreements with CIJ, enabling their researchers to publish under preferential terms.
Partners benefit from international indexing, editorial infrastructure, branded publication channels, usage analytics, and priority editorial support.
Academic societies and professional associations may partner with CIJ to launch or migrate official journals while retaining full editorial independence.
CIJ provides advanced editorial systems, publishing infrastructure, and access to a global author and reviewer network.
CIJ partners with international research networks, consortia, and funded programmes to develop dedicated publishing channels.
This includes customised journal platforms, rapid-review pipelines, and programme-specific open books for large-scale research outputs.
CIJ collaborates with national research councils, development agencies, and intergovernmental organisations to strengthen open-access publishing ecosystems.
These partnerships include subsidised publishing, editorial capacity-building, and tailored dissemination strategies.
